South of South Haven, in the middle of the Blueberry patch.

I'm firing up the Sprayer in about 3 hours to get after the Mummy Berry, that just started to go to trumpets, and Phomopsis/Anthracnose.

Generally, when the Mummy Berry apothecium starts opening up, the first smaller Morels can be found in the woodlot or within a couple days, so it's real close...

This weekend is supposed to be warm, and I'm betting it will bee good hunting by Sunday.
